针对初学者,搭建一个高效的开发环境至关重要。本文将介绍如何快速安装和使用编程语言软件,同时分享一些DIY组装和性能优化的建议,以帮助新手更好地体验编程的乐趣。

搭建开发环境的第一步是选择合适的硬件。市场上有许多配置供选择,一台具备较强性能的电脑显然会让编程变得更加顺畅。例如,搭载最新处理器的机型能够支持多个任务的同时运行,提升开发效率。而针对图形密集型或者数据处理需求较高的语言,如Python或Java,配备适量的内存和SSD固态硬盘尤为重要。
针对初学者,推荐使用较为简单的操作系统,例如Windows、macOS或Ubuntu。Ubuntu是一个非常友好的Linux发行版,尤其适合编程爱好者。安装过程也较为简单,通过U盘启动即可完成系统的安装,同时也可参考官方文档进行详细设置。一旦操作系统成功安装,接下来便可以安装编程所需的软件开发工具。
对于编程语言的选择,Python因其简洁明了的语法,很适合初学者。安装Python在各大操作系统中都非常简便,只需访问官网下载安装包,并根据提示完成安装即可。安装完成后,通过命令行运行Python脚本,会发现其运行速度快、调试方便,非常符合新手的需求。
Java和C++也是市场上广泛使用的编程语言。对于Java的安装,可以直接下载JDK(Java Development Kit),设置环境变量后,便可在命令行中运行Java程序。而C++编译器的选择则在于是否需要图形界面的IDE,常用的如Visual Studio和Code::Blocks都提供了安装指导,适合不同需求的用户。
除了安装开发环境,初学者还需掌握一些简单的性能优化技巧。这包括关闭后台不必要的程序、定期清理系统缓存以及及时更新驱动程序。对于DIY组装电脑的用户,通过选择合适的散热器和电源,可以确保机器在高负载情况下能够稳定运行。定期对硬件进行维护和清理,也能有效延长设备的使用寿命。
对于新手来说,这些基础知识不仅帮助其迅速上手编程,也为后续深入学习打下了良好的基础。理解硬件性能特性以及软件开发工具的使用,将使初学者在编程的道路上走得更远。
常见问题解答:
1. 新手需要学习哪种编程语言?
Python非常适合初学者,因为它的语法简洁易懂,使用广泛。
2. 如何选择合适的开发环境?
根据自己的编程需求选择适合的操作系统和IDE,Windows、macOS和Ubuntu都是不错的选择。
3. 是否需要了解硬件知识?
基础的硬件知识有助于更好地选择和配置机器,尤其是在DIY组装时。
4. 如何确保开发环境的性能?
定期清理系统和更新驱动,必要时可升级硬件配置。
5. 安装编程软件时给出什么建议?
选择官方渠道下载软件,并仔细阅读安装文档,确保一切设置正确。
